Work with persons with disabilities

 The UN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ities defines persons with disabilities as ‘those who have long-term physical, mental, intellectual or sensory impairments which in interaction with various barriers may hinder their full and effective participation in society on an equal basis with others’ (https://commission.europa.eu/).

The variety of persons with disabilities is very wide as you can see above from the UN definition. Disabled persons have to have the same opportunities and rights to be part of the society as the no-disabled persons, also in digital environment (Disability Services Act). To make this right possible, the tools of digital media have to be made suitable for different disabilities. So what kind of methods could be used in our work?

Because of the wide area of different disabilities, I wanted to find some examples of tools that can help in basic life in communication and participation. When a person has problems with verbal communication the basic digital equipment, computer, tablet or smartphone can be helpful. As professionals we should be able to guide the clients to the available options. As important as helping the clients to get the equipment they need, is to know how to use them ourselves. In client work we have to meet the people and the best way to do it is in person. But when a person has the kind of disabilities that one can´t move easily from one place to another, we have to use digital interaction. Digital interaction is a good way to make it possible for a disabled person to reach social contacts. In Innokylä webpages you can find an interesting development project about this subject, Digivuorovaikutus osallisuuden tukena asiakastyössä

Digitalization is present in every day´s work more and more. As professionals, it´s important to keep up with the development so we can do the work with our clients. But today, it´s still a little in client workers own hands to learn the digital world. In a thesis project of Samuli Soininen; Digitalization embedded in work with disabled people, you can find important results for developing the digitalization in work. The personnel need education of the digital tools and they have to have enough those tools. Also the management has to give support for the development. So we could maybe say that digital development is team work between clients, client workers and the management.
